I want to try one of those hardy geraniums with black foliage. Does anyone know if they're very vigorous, and which one would be the most vigorous? Does anyone know if they do better or worse than the green leaved varieties in areas with only 3 hours of AM sun? Or would they hardly flower? Thanks, Deanna

HI Deanna, I have a black foliage one, actually two. One with small leaves and the other large. The large leaf one is Midnite Reiter or something like that. Does great in semishade, but the leaves do start to turn a bit green. I have mine planted next to Anne Folkard. The other cranesbill is called Porter's Pass. A very small hardy geranium and not so vigorous.

I have a little one called espresso.it is not very vigorous and is in full sun flowering in may-june for about 4 weeks.
